Moringa Oleifera: A Review Of Pharmacological And Phytochemical Potentials

Moringa oleifera L. (family: Moringaceae) is a highly effective therapeutic herb with tremendous nutritional value. It is an edible herb and cheaply grows in tropical areas of India, Pakistan and Bangladesh. It considers as a super food because consists phenolic acids, zeatin, β-carotene, flavonoids, quercetin, phenolic compounds and isothiocyanates. M. oleifera is also a source of micro and macro nutrients like phosphorus, potassium, iron, calcium, carbohydrate, protein that helps in proper functioning of body. Various parts of moringa such as root, bark, seed buds, stem, leaves are having different biological actions described as anti-inflammatory, neuroprotective, anti-hyperlipidaemic, cytotoxic, anti-diabetic, antimicrobial effects helpful in various disorders treatment. According to largest studies Moringa oleifera employed as potential ingredient of food. This review emphasized on therapeutic, medicinal as well as edible properties of Moringa oleifera by gaining novel opinion for future researches and developments.
